Manufacturing boom: Trade school enrollment soarsAccording to a July 2012 Industrial Production report from the Federal Reserve, output in the manufacturing sector increased .7% in June. In the second quarter of 2012, manufacturing output rose 1.4%; fueled largely by an 18.2% increase in the motor vehicles & parts category. A recent CNNMoney article by Parija Kavilanz titled “Manufacturing boom: Trade school enrollment soars”, discusses the impact the growing manufacturing sector has on Trade school enrollment/job fulfillment. Parija cites examples of Trade schools that are implementing new/creative programs to face the challenges of surging enrollments.
